Written Answers. - County Cork Roadway Collapse.

316.

asked the Minister for the Environment if he is aware of the serious hardship being caused to residents in the Cahermore-Allihies area of County Cork due to the collapse of a public roadway; if his Department have costed its repair; if he will make the necessary funds available to carry out the work; if so, when work will commence; and if he will make a statement on the matter.

The primary responsibility in regard to this road, including the provision of funds for whatever works may be necessary, rests on Cork County Council. The council have informed my Department that their engineering staff are examining the position to determine the extent of the problem and prepare a detailed estimate of the cost of repair. I intend providing some road grant assistance towards the council's costs and I am making an initial allocation of £50,000 available immediately for this purpose.
